Accelerating Musical Live Coding With On-Device AI
Alex Hinson · Fleetio · Day 2
AI and Strudel — web-based music production tool.
Make music with code!
Extend creativity, not replace it — using AI to get help, not handing something to AI to do.
Structural awareness — a small model under the hood helping with the technical bits.
In your browser tab! No API, no cloud — all local.
Why local
Alex wants to:
- keep cost down — free!
- reduce latency — beats having a round-trip
- privacy — input never leaves the browser
So that's why local.
Getting a small model good at a niche domain
How do you get a small model to be good at a niche domain?
Pick a model — but first pick which type of model?
transformers.js— HuggingFace models to run in the browser.
Is this problem translation? Is it audio classification? Each one is in a different model family.
Text generation made the most sense; what does the interface look like?
Shaping the model's I/O —
- AI good at ambiguity, inference, unstructured input
- Code good at precision, rules, and structured output
The right answer depends on the need.
Finding the AI/code boundary
- Off-the-shelf model: ask for code — NOT right! Looks plausible, but won't run.
- Try intent JSON — deterministic engine; take intent and make pseudo code.
A continuum of AI <——> code boundary, with tradeoffs between them.
Latency to get a structured output; bigger schema, bigger prompt — doesn't feel fluid anymore.
- Try fine-tuned -> structural context. Keep input context small; model output is sanitized and parsed.
- Optimized — remove the deterministic guarantee for tighter and smaller surface area, just the right amount of tokens.
But the model didn't know Strudel! Training took a lot more time.
Training data
There wasn't a lot of training data available — didn't have time to create a lot of examples.
Alex used LLMs to generate examples; ask for Strudel, see what it does.
Some things didn't actually exist — confident nonsense.
- Added validation step — run it through Strudel, throw it out if it doesn't parse.
- Then scale — DON'T scale the hallucinations.
Added grounding to what the LLM is being asked to do; don't freestyle, be concise — what is Strudel.
Cross-domain reasoning.
The ongoing loop
The work gets focused but doesn't stop; identify gap -> generate -> validate -> retrain.
identify gap -> generate -> validate -> retrain
Each loop makes the tool better — to become something Alex wants to work with.
Shrink it to fit
Make something small enough to fit in a browser tab — shrink it small, ship it small.
Quantization!
- Shrink down by reducing precision.
- Runtime in a few lines — import, await pipeline, initialize.
